Frank,

I am sure you're gonna get a few responses to your battery statement!

When the engine is running and the battery charged, battery voltage is greater than 12 volts (I read 14.1-14.2 at the battery). The alternator output is limited to whatever the voltage reg is set at (13.8-14.4) not 12 volts.

If you only read 12 volts across the pos and neg of your battery when the engine is running then you have alternator and/or battery problems.

The battery must be charged at a voltage higher than 12, the upper limit being a compromise between charge rate and over charge. Gel cell batteries have a slightly different charge profile (both equalisation and float).

I get approx 14.0 at the dash voltmeter with no load. The addition of two 8 gauge power lines running up to the front (for aux light and relayed head lights) makes a big difference in the measured voltage drop when those aforementioned loads are applied. Used to be (with stock wiring) when I turned on all the electrical loads the voltmeter would drop below 12V (wipers, blower, lights, rear defrogger etc), now with the same loads plus a 250W aux light the voltage bottoms out at 12.5)
